Law Firm:Wulfsberg Reese Colvig & Firstman Professional Corporation
Lawyer:William L. Darby
Phone:510-835-9100
Fax:510-451-2170
Lawyer Title:Principal
Practice Areas:Construction Litigation; Commercial Litigation
Bio:
Admitted:1988, California, U.S. Court of Appeals, Ninth Circuit and U.S. District Court, Northern, Southern and Eastern Districts of California
College:Carleton College, B.A., cum laude, 1983
Law School:University of Minnesota, J.D., cum laude, 1987
Membership:Alameda County Bar Association; State Bar of California.
